Introduction to OTC Network Retailer Applications

OTC network retailer applications are digital platforms designed to streamline the operations of retailers dealing with over-the-counter (OTC) products. These applications serve as centralized hubs for managing inventory, processing orders, and interacting with suppliers, all while providing a secure and efficient workflow. They’re a crucial tool for businesses in the OTC sector, enabling them to optimize their operations and better serve customers.These applications typically feature modules for managing product listings, inventory tracking, order processing, and customer relationship management (CRM).

Advanced applications often integrate with payment gateways and logistics providers, offering a comprehensive solution for the entire sales cycle. They’re built to enhance efficiency and profitability for retailers, and they provide an organized system for managing the complexities of OTC product sales.

Typical Functionalities

OTC network retailer applications are equipped with a range of functionalities, including robust inventory management tools, efficient order processing systems, and streamlined communication channels with suppliers. These applications are crucial for maintaining accurate records of stock levels, tracking orders from placement to delivery, and managing supplier relationships. They also often include features for reporting and analytics, allowing retailers to gain valuable insights into their sales performance and identify areas for improvement.

  • Inventory Management: Applications provide real-time tracking of inventory levels, allowing retailers to quickly identify stockouts and avoid delays. This automated system helps prevent overstocking, reducing storage costs and waste.
  • Order Processing: These applications streamline the entire order fulfillment process, from order placement to delivery. Automated notifications and confirmations ensure smooth transactions and timely order fulfillment, enhancing customer satisfaction.
  • Supplier Management: Streamlined communication channels and automated order placement features simplify interactions with suppliers. This reduces manual tasks, allowing retailers to focus on other crucial aspects of their business.
  • Customer Relationship Management (CRM): Applications enable the management of customer interactions, including order history, preferences, and communication records. This facilitates personalized service and builds stronger customer relationships.

Pricing Models

Various pricing models are employed by different applications, each with its own set of benefits and drawbacks. Some applications utilize a freemium model, offering basic functionalities for free and charging for premium features. Others opt for a subscription-based model, providing access to a wider range of features over a defined period. Finally, some applications use a transaction-based model, charging fees for specific services or products.
